 WORKSHOP ROTATION SUNDAY SCHOOL

At Green’s Farms Church, we’re passionate about Sunday School!  We welcome children into an environment where they can feel God’s love.  We introduce them to God’s story as told in the Bible.  And we encourage each child to develop a personal relationship with God.  

Preschool through kindergarten students meet in age appropriate classrooms led by trained volunteers and directed by an experienced teacher.  Grades 1 – 5 rotate to different workshops that become theaters, kitchens, garden centers, painting studios, etc., and are led by trained volunteers or subject matter experts under the guidance of Children’s Ministry Director, Lynn Rider. 

We know that children learn best and retain what they learn longer when they are immersed in a fully interactive environment.  Children and their families are active and involved in their lessons through a variety of activities designed to reach many different kinds of learners.  When children are encouraged to learn by using their own unique gifts they come to know God and grow in faith in a way that makes sense to them, and ultimately informs every aspect of their lives.  Come join us and try Sunday School like you have never experienced it before!

MIDDLE SCHOOL AND CONFIRMATION

Middle School and confirmation groups are led by volunteers working in close cooperation with Senior Minister, Jeff Rider.  We are always in the process of evaluating our program for this age group and determining how best to meet their needs.  As we undertake that process, we offer Sunday morning education, as well as periodic field trips and activities.  On Sunday mornings, Karen Kosinski teaches the 7th and 8th grade class and Dawn Collins and Brad Cosgrove teach 6th grade.

Beginning in January, 8th graders will attend Tuesday evening confirmation classes, which will be taught by Jeffrey Rider and Amy Forté, and a team of three volunteers:  Gary Domenico, Thad Eidman and Karen Kosinski.  All five will act as mentors and assist with instruction.  Each of them has a passion for serving youth and a gift for connecting with kids.  We are grateful for their energetic commitment to the future of Green's Farms Church -- our youth.

YOUTH MINISTRY TEAM

High school students meet every Thursday evening for discussion of a wide range of issues related to faith.  They also get together socially and participate throughout the year in a variety of activities in preparation for an annual mission trip.  Last year's group, 16 strong, traveled to Grand Bahama Island where they built a community bath house for the homeless and led a Vacation Bible School for neighborhood children.  For the second year our Youth Ministry Team will be led by Amy Forté and Karen Kosinski.
